Abstract

A battery-powered, handheld grease gun for dispensing lubricant. A pump mechanism driven by a motor is in communication with the lubricant and has a supply port for dispensing the lubricant at a lubrication point. A sensor monitors the pump mechanism of the motor. A display displays information indicative of the monitored condition of the device, such as volume of lubricant dispensed. A processor responsive to operator input selectively energizes the motor to drive the pump mechanism to dispense lubricant.
